From c2d42d97d2b6de9e65e70d21abcf01c61cdd0a58 Mon Sep 17 00:00:00 2001 From: luchenqun Date: Fri, 5 May 2017 10:14:04 +0800 Subject: [PATCH] =?UTF-8?q?=E5=88=9D=E5=A7=8B=E5=8C=96=E5=8E=86=E5=8F=B2?= =?UTF-8?q?=E6=90=9C=E7=B4=A2=E6=97=B6=E6=9C=BA?= MIME-Version: 1.0 Content-Type: text/plain; charset=UTF-8 Content-Transfer-Encoding: 8bit --- public/scripts/controllers/menus-controller.js | 12 ------------ public/scripts/directives/js-init-directive.js | 5 +++++ 2 files changed, 5 insertions(+), 12 deletions(-) diff --git a/public/scripts/controllers/menus-controller.js b/public/scripts/controllers/menus-controller.js index 888f4a6..1d5f342 100644 --- a/public/scripts/controllers/menus-controller.js +++ b/public/scripts/controllers/menus-controller.js @@ -205,18 +205,6 @@ app.controller('menuCtr', ['$scope', '$stateParams', '$state', '$window', '$time bookmarkService.userInfo({}) .then((data) => { $scope.searchHistory = JSON.parse(data.search_history || '[]'); - var count = 1; - var id = setInterval(function() { - var items = $('.search-item').popup({ - on: 'focus', - inline: true - }); - console.log("searchHistory = ", items.length, JSON.stringify(data.search_history)); - count++; - if (items.length >= 1 || count >= 20) { - clearInterval(id); - } - }, 200); }) .catch((err) => { console.log(err); diff --git a/public/scripts/directives/js-init-directive.js b/public/scripts/directives/js-init-directive.js index 880f7eb..6271612 100644 --- a/public/scripts/directives/js-init-directive.js +++ b/public/scripts/directives/js-init-directive.js @@ -177,6 +177,11 @@ app.directive('jsMenuInit', function($compile) { $('.ui.menu a.item').on('click', function() { $(this).addClass('selected').siblings().removeClass('selected'); }); + + $('.search-item').popup({ + on: 'focus', + inline: true + }); } }, };